Excluding what the Saints gave away in the original draft for Williams (#1, #1, #3,#3,#4,#5,#6,#7). Just how much are the Saints really getting from the Ricky trade. Sure we all know somewhat how much the phins are trading. However how much are the Saints really recieving.
The Dolphins traded a #1 and a conditional pick (#1-#3 dependant on performance) for Ricky Williams and to move up in the 4th round in a swap of 4th round picks (which we got a bona fide possible future ProBowl TE).
The 1st rounder we gave this year is discounted. Why you ask? The Saints spent a higher 1st rounder on Deuce McAllister with the express intent of getting rid of Ricky at some point (You don't spend a 1st rounder for a backup RB).
Right now it looks like the Saints traded Ricky for a 2nd (based on how is season is going it looks like a solid 1400 yard season).
However hold on. The phins in that deal got to move up in the 4th round. How valuable is that? That would have costed a 5th rounder.
So in essence the Saints traded Ricky for most likely a tarnished 2nd rounder (since there was a trade up for the phins in the 4th round this year and they spent a higher #1 on drafting Deuce then they recieved back).
